The Windshield problem

I own a 2005 Toyota Tacoma. When driven at freeway speeds, the front windshield seals begin to vibrate and create an exceedingly loud squeal along the top of the front windshield. This noise sounds like a siren and is very startling. The first time this happened, I almost drove off the road.   Read details...

The Visibility problem

Driver's side visor bracket breaks and visor wll not stay up out of the way and blocks driver's view.   Read details...
